Eliza Morales, 30, was found dead after an apartment fire on Monday night.
Nedas Revuckas, 19, is charged with first-degree murder, armed robbery, arson, and animal cruelty.
The incident occurred after Revuckas allegedly became upset about the condition of a pickup truck he intended to buy from Morales' husband on Facebook Marketplace.
Court documents indicate Morales suffered 70 stab wounds during a struggle with Revuckas.
Revuckas allegedly started a fire in the home after the stabbing.
